Understanding Reversible Welded Hydraulic Cylinders
Reversible welded hydraulic cylinders are hydraulic actuators that utilize fluid power to create linear motion. These cylinders consist of essential components such as the cylinder, piston, rod, and end cap, all meticulously crafted from high-quality materials like steel or stainless steel. One of their key design characteristics is reversibility, allowing them to operate bidirectionally with ease.

Working Principle
The working principle of reversible welded hydraulic cylinders involves the controlled extension and contraction of the cylinder through the flow and pressure of hydraulic fluid. This mechanism enables precise and powerful movement, essential for a wide range of applications across industries.

3. How do reversible welded hydraulic cylinders differ from single-acting cylinders?
Reversible welded hydraulic cylinders have the ability to operate bidirectionally, unlike single-acting cylinders that can only extend or retract in one direction. This dual-action capability makes reversible cylinders more versatile and efficient.
